"COPY" Commands in Linux. 7. This command helps you copy one file to another. cp file1 file2. 8. Copy all files of a directory within the current work directory. cp dir/* . 9. Copy a directory within the current work directory. cp -a /tmp/dir1 . 10. Copy a directory. cp -a dir1 dir2. 11. May 04, 2019 · Linux will keep the contents of memory in the buffers to help having to access the same data over-and-over from the slower disk drive. If your buffers/cache free memory is low or your swap free is low a memory upgrade is necessary.

Linux tcpdump command is the most used command in network analysis among other Linux network commands. It captures the traffic that is passing through the network interface and displays it. This kind of access to the packet will be crucial when troubleshooting the network.
